Everyday, we experience sound in our environment, such as the noises from tv and radio, household devices, and traffic. Normally, these sounds go to secure degrees that don't damage our hearing. Sounds can be hazardous when they are also loud, also for a brief time, or when they are both loud and lasting.
NIHL can be immediate or it can take a long time to be visible. It can be short-lived or irreversible, and it can impact one ear or both ears. Also if you can not inform that you are damaging your hearing, you could have problem hearing in the future, such as not being able to recognize various other individuals when they speak, especially on the phone or in a noisy area.
Direct exposure to hazardous sound can happen at any age. Individuals of all ages, including kids, teens, young grownups, and older individuals, can establish NIHL. Based on a 2011-2012 CDC study entailing hearing examinations and interviews with individuals, at the very least 10 million grownups (6 percent) in the united state under age 70and probably as lots of as 40 million adults (24 percent)have attributes of their hearing test that recommend hearing loss in one or both ears from exposure to loud sound.
Sounds at or below 70 A-weighted decibels (dBA), also after long direct exposure, are not likely to create hearing loss. Lengthy or repetitive exposure to audios at or over 85 dBA can trigger hearing loss.
A great guideline is to prevent sounds that are as well loud, as well close, or last also long. Hearing relies on a series of events that transform acoustic waves in the air into electrical signals
Resource: NIH/NIDCD Sound waves go into the external ear and traveling through a slim passage called the ear canal, which causes the eardrum. The eardrum vibrates from the incoming audio waves and sends these resonances to 3 tiny bones in the center ear. These bones are called the malleus, incus, and stapes.
As the hair cells relocate up and down, microscopic hair-like estimates (referred to as stereocilia) that perch in addition to the hair cells bump against an overlying framework and bend. Bending causes pore-like channels, which are at the suggestions of the stereocilia, to open. When that takes place, chemicals hurry into the cell, creating an electric signal.

Much acoustic trauma is caused by impulse noise, which is generally due to blast effect and the rapid expansion of gases. Impact noise results from the crash of steels.
Effect sound is more most likely to be seen in the context of work noise exposure. Animals with big PTS from a first noise exposure revealed much less PTS adhering to second sound exposure at a particular intensity contrasted with animals with little or no previous NIHL, suggesting that these pets are less sensitive to succeeding sound direct exposures.
This recommends that the significant variable in charge of these results is reduced effective intensity of the second noise for the ears with huge initial PTS. Other physiologic conditions that affect the probability and progression of NIHL have actually been recognized. Evidence shows up in the literature that decreased body temperature, raised oxygen tension, reduced totally free radical formation, and elimination of the thyroid gland can all decrease a person's level of sensitivity to NIHL.
Great experimental proof shows that sustained exposure to reasonably high levels of sound can decrease an individual's level of sensitivity to NIHL at higher degrees of sound. This procedure is described as sound conditioning. It goes to least superficially similar to the protective impact a purposeful training program has for serious exercise.
